The Official Podcast of the Stockton Ports, the Class A Advanced Affiliate of the Oakland Athletics and 11-Time California League Champions. #SeasTheDay

4.2 - Sam Given

4.2 - Sam Given

A's Minor League Video Assistant Sam Given, who spent last season in Stockton, joins the show. A fun conversation involving the video and data side of player development and how it factors in to helping a player improve and assisting a coaching staff with overall operations.
